one. What is laser hair removing?
Laser hair removal is a procedure in which hair is removed from the body employing a long pulse laser. Light at a stated wavelength is delivered from a handpiece into the skin. The laser targets dark material, which is mostly the pigment in the hair. The laser then disables hairs that are in their growth cycle at the time of treatment. Because other hairs will enter their expansion cycle at various times, one or two treatments are required for perfect results.
2. What are the advantages of laser hair removal?
Many patients have experienced enduring hair removal or permanent hair reduction due to their treatments. Although laser hair removing can be really effective, you should expect some re-growth. However , many patients have pointed to the fact that hair regrowth is usually lighter in color or finer in texture.
3. Who is an applicant for laser hair removing?
Not everyone is an ideal applicant for laser hair removal. It works best on people with light skin and dark, coarse hair. Nonetheless if you don’t have this precise skin type, do not give up hope. Visit a couple of hospitals and see what they have to claim. Technology is quickly advancing and many lasers are now able to work with a variety of types of skin. As an example, the Alexandrite long pulse and diode sorts of lasers work the best on light-colored skin, while ND:YAG long heartbeat lasers work better on darker skin. It’s best to consult a licensed laser hair removing expert to see what options are available to you.
